After five episodes of buildup, Resident Alien season 4 has finally fulfilled a major alien story setup that will deeply impact everything yet to come. Resident Alien season 4 has focused on the multifaceted stories of aliens in Patience and their interactions with human characters. Even Harry getting used to being human falls into this category throughout his adjustment period.

However, he and his friends haven’t been alone, with other characters in Resident Alien experiencing their own conflicts with extraterrestrials. This includes Ben and Kate, whose baby D’Arcy rescued from the Greys at the end of Resident Alien season 3. As their search for answers continued, season 4, episode 5 tied even more key characters into their mission.

Mike & Liv Now Know Ben & Kate’s Baby Was Stolen By The Greys

Meredith Garretson looking upset as Kate Hawthorne in Resident Alien

During a dinner at Ben and Kate’s house, Mike and Liv discover one of the cameras D’Arcy secretly put in the Hawthorne home. Thinking they’re Ben and Kate’s, they confront them, only for the couple to suspect the Greys. This causes them to tell Patience’s police duo that Kate’s baby had been abducted by aliens.

While the episode doesn’t reveal Mike and Liv’s reaction, the pair have had their fair share of recent alien encounters. While none of them know Harry’s secret, the Sheriff and Deputy have been investigating murders committed by the now-deceased Mantid. They’re both believers who’ve witnessed alien activity, meaning they’ll probably believe Kate’s story about her missing child too.

This firmly interlocks their stories, since they might start investigating all of Patience’s alien activity as connected to one another. It slowly inches them toward discovering the truth about Harry as well, whose sudden disappearance at the end of Resident Alien season 4, episode 5 means Asta and D’Arcy might have to deal with this new alliance without him.

What Kate’s Revelation Means For Resident Alien Season 4’s Story

Now that the Hawthorne’s, Mike, and Liv have found hidden cameras, they’ll likely try investigating where they came from. This could lead them back to D’Arcy, who planted them there so she could monitor Grey activity in their home. But, if they do discover she’s the one behind them, it would put their baby, Daisy, at risk of being discovered.

Since Ben and Kate don’t know their baby is on Earth, though, they wouldn’t have any idea their investigation is putting her at risk. The same goes for Mike and Liv, whose only interaction with Greys has been Mike killing one of them. This makes their upcoming Resident Alien storyline more tense, as their investigation could unknowingly endanger their child.
